## Session Handling — Fernwick Scheduler

Sessions for the Fernwick watering scheduler expire after 30 minutes of inactivity. If on-call sees widespread 401s, check the session store on the Dewpoint cluster first; a full store evicts oldest sessions silently. Restarting the auth pod forces re-login for all users, so prefer a rolling restart. To verify the session endpoint manually, call it with the token below.

bearer token for fahap-taduf: eyJhbGciOiJIUzI1NiIsInR5cCI6IkpXVCJ9.eyJzdWIiOiIdb2jwwh2M-In0.jQLm6X5pZ7uw

CI note: thumbnail queue backlog

The Driftbox thumbnail queue stalls when a corrupt TIFF poisons a worker. Fixed: workers now dead-letter after two decode failures instead of retrying forever. Support: if users report missing previews, check the dead-letter count first, then requeue via the admin panel. Backlog should drain within ten minutes of a deploy. The fixed build is identified below.

pipeline stamp: htk9_ce63042d9

# Artifact Signing — GridSpill Exports

Quick note for the sync: the memory fix for large spreadsheet exports ships this week as GridSpill 4.2. Because export workers only load signed bundles, anyone cutting the build needs to run the signing step — no exceptions, even for the hotfix branch. Signing for this release uses the key below.

signing key of baduf-taweg = bky6_Zf7bem

# Project Saltmere — Status (Managers Only)

Saltmere, the inventory overhaul, is now six months behind schedule. Root causes: vendor turnover and underscoped data migration. Branch managers should plan on the legacy Cordant system through next fiscal year. Revised milestones post monthly. The strategic reasoning behind keeping this quiet is noted below.

internal memo for kawip-hadug: Headcount on the Wenwyn team goes from 7 to 140 by the end of January. Gross margin on Wenwyn came in at 20 percent against a plan of 15 percent.